FINANCE REVIEW SUMMARY

Heads-up for the sales leads: the Bramwick team's budget request for extra demo kits and two regional hires cleared first review. Numbers look sane — payback inside three quarters if pipeline holds. Final sign-off lands next week, so keep forecasts tight until then. The confidential note below covers the plan this is meant to support.

confidential, yajof-fadug: Project Julvan slips by one quarter because of the audit delay.

## Changelog 3.1.0 — Contrast Defaults Updated

Following the Duskfield accessibility audit, default theme tokens in the Hollowpane UI kit now meet a 4.5:1 contrast ratio. Muted text, disabled buttons, and chart gridlines were the main offenders and have been darkened. Custom themes are unaffected unless they inherit the base palette. The updated default values are listed below.

config for bagep-kageg:
ULADOR_LOG_LEVEL=warn
ULADOR_METRICS_HOST=metrics.ulador.tolvaqcorp.corp
ULADOR_POOL_SIZE=32

HANDOVER — Commission Scheme Revision

To the incoming director: the revised scheme goes live on the 1st. Key changes: accelerators start at 110% of quota, not 100%; multi-year Quillstone deals pay out over term, not upfront; clawbacks extend to nine months. Reps were briefed last week — expect pushback from the Ashgrove pod. Payroll mapping is done; Tomas owns the calculator. Disputes route through RevOps, not you. One outstanding item: the enterprise override rate is unresolved. Background for that decision sits below.

internal memo for kahif-kawig: Project Fravan slips by two quarters because of the tooling delay.

Q3 Planning Note — Training Budget

Branch managers: next year's training allocation is set at roughly the same level as this year, with a modest shift toward the new Kelbrook compliance modules. Submit your branch estimates by end of month so central planning can finalize figures. Unused funds will not roll over. Please also note the following for planning context:

board note of kageg-bahof: The renewal with Holwynax Holdings closes at $2 million a year, 5 percent below the last contract. Project Ulaath slips by two quarters because of the supplier delay.